Check the License, Not the Color

Here is the deal: a legit license is the backbone. It tells you the operator is vetted, audited, and forced to play by the rules. If the license is hidden in fine print, run. Real credibility doesn’t wear a flashy banner; it hides in a reputable regulator’s name.

Payment Flexibility

Speed matters. Withdrawals that linger are a silent killer. Look for crypto, e‑wallets, and instant bank transfers. A platform that supports several methods shows it trusts its users. Trust is a two‑way street; you don’t want to be stuck waiting for weeks.

Bonus Terms—Read the Fine Print

Look: bonuses are bait, not a gift. A 100% match sounds sweet until you hit a 30‑times rollover on a single sport. Scrutinize the wagering requirements—if they’re higher than the average, the bonus is a trap. You want low rollover, high cash‑out flexibility.

Customer Support—Your Safety Net

By the way, test the chat. A live agent that answers within seconds shows the operator invests in you. Automated bots that loop you around are a sign of low commitment. When you’re on a losing streak, you need a human ear.

Reputation and Community Feedback

Here’s a shortcut: check forums, Reddit threads, and review sites. Real‑world experiences surface the hidden gems and the scams. Trust the collective voice more than the glossy marketing copy.
